Abstract

The utility model relates to a dynamic environmental tester of mini car steering tie rod assembly rubber part, which comprises a special environmental test box and an exercise testing-stand and a control system; wherein, the testing-stand is arranged on a trestle supporting base in an internal chamber of a box body; a drive shaft is connected with a motor. The box body is provided with a motor, an ozone generator, a turbid water spray system, a heating and cooling device and a control system, and the control circuit of the control system is connected with the motor, the ozone generator, the turbid water spray system, the heating and cooling device, the control panel and the computer interface respectively; the testing-stand has a horizontal movement structure and a spatial swing structure. The device integrates the special environmental test box, the exercise testing-stand and the control system organically, and provides multiple environmental conditions as the temperature environment, the ozone atmosphere and the turbid water turbid water, which can promote the testing level and control the quality of the rubber parts; two sets of optional testing-stands are designed, and the structure is reasonable and compact; the whole dynamic environmental testing process is controlled by the control system exactly; the operation is stable and reliable and the testing operation is simple and convenient.

Technical field
The utility model belongs to auto parts and components test, detection technique field, is specifically related to a kind of device that is used for minicar steering linkage assembly rubber part is carried out the dynamic environment test.
Technical background
Rubber components such as gear side dust cover, tooth bar side dust cover are the important components of minicar steering linkage assembly, be assemblied in gear one side and tooth bar one side of steering linkage, major function is to be used to protect the steering linkage kinematic train to resist road sandstone bump, muddy water spray and atmospheric environment corrosion, guarantees that minicar turns to flexible function safety.For confirming that minicar turning-bar assembly rubber component bears fatigue stress and resists the environmental attack ability, just need carry out the dynamic environment test to steering linkage assembly rubber part.
The test of rubber part dynamic environment is an emerging detection experimental technique, its ultimate principle is under lab to simulate the accelerated motion torture test of carrying out under the working motion situation of rubber part and the environmental baseline, the overall quality level of qualitative and quantitative evaluation rubber part.The domestic research work that relates to the experimental technique of motor turning rod assembly at present is primarily aimed at the reliability and the durability test of metal parts such as steering linkage and ball stud, and is the dynamic test of not considering environmental factor.For example: the design and the research of dynamic testing equipments such as automotive steering linkage's vibration at high-speed test unit, steering linkage and ball stud life test rack, intelligent vehicle steering linkage connector assembly testing table and motor turning rod head assembly multi-function test stand.Domestic research report about the rubber part experimental technique is very few, and the research of the rubber part dynamic environment test unit of motor turning rod assembly still belongs to blank.Processing technology and the comparatively backward present situation of detection technique based on domestic elastomeric material, product parts, the quality instability of the rubber part of domestic automobile (minicar) steering linkage assembly, serviceable life is very low, particularly gear side dust cover and tooth bar side dust cover cracking, broken crisp phenomenon are serious, have directly influenced the steering behaviour and the security performance of automobile.In order to address this problem, a dynamic environment test such as rubber parts such as the gear side dust cover of motor turning rod assembly, tooth bar side dust cover, ball pin dust cover must pass through weatherability, normal temperature distortion, rigidity, temperature deformation, normal temperature is durable, low temperature is durable, high temperature is durable, low temperature resistance, heatproof degree variability, muddy water spray.
Summary of the invention
The purpose of this utility model is at existing experimental technique above shortcomings, a kind of device that is used for minicar steering linkage assembly rubber part is carried out the dynamic environment test is proposed, for the rubber part dynamic test provides environmental baseline (as temperature environment, ozone atmosphere and muddy water spray etc.) and forms of motion (comprising the flexible and space swing of level) simultaneously, reasonable in design, compactness, it is reliable to operate steadily, and test operation is easy.
To achieve these goals, technical solution of the present utility model is as follows:
Minicar steering linkage assembly rubber part dynamic environment test unit, constitute by private environment chamber, exercise test stand and control system three parts, the exercise test stand is installed on the stand supporting seat in the chamber inner chamber, and the transmission shaft of exercise test stand connects the power output of motor.Motor, ozone generator, muddy water spray equipment, heating and cooling device and control system also are installed in the private environment chamber, control system connects motor, ozone generator, muddy water spray equipment, heating and cooling device respectively by operation circuit, and by line connection control panel and computer interface.
According to the actual motion form of rubber part, the exercise test stand of this test unit has two covers selective:
One cover is horizontal contractile motion test-bed, it is to be installed on the chamber stand supporting seat by bracing frame, the transmission shaft that is connected with motor is set on the bracing frame, wheel disc is installed on the transmission shaft, wheel disc connects slide block by connecting rod, and slide block is installed on the slide block bearing, and is provided with sample supporting rod A, the position sample supporting rod B relative with the direction of motion of slide block, sample supporting rod B is fixed on the bracing frame.
The another set of test-bed that provides the space oscillating motion, it is to be installed on the chamber stand supporting seat by bracing frame, the transmission shaft that is connected with motor is set on the bracing frame, wheel disc is installed on the transmission shaft, wheel disc connects rocking bar by connecting rod again, and rocking bar is provided with sample bare terminal end C, and rocking bar connects sample supporting rod one end by bearing pin, bare terminal end D is arranged on the sample supporting rod, and the sample supporting rod is fixed on the bracing frame.The connecting rod of this stand is an adjustable structure, is connected to connect by the adjustable connecting-rod at two and middle screw rod to form, and adjustable connecting-rod is connected by connecting pin with wheel disc, and wheel disc has the radiai adjustment groove in the junction.
This device organically is integrated in one private environment chamber, exercise test stand and control system three parts, multiple environmental baselines such as temperature environment, ozone atmosphere and muddy water spray are provided simultaneously, the test condition design is thorough, the weatherability, normal temperature distortion, rigidity, temperature deformation, the many indexs such as normal temperature is durable, low temperature is durable, high temperature is durable, low temperature resistance, heatproof degree variability, muddy water spray that can be used for the testing rubber part, improve detection level, helped controlling the rubber part quality; Provide level flexible and two kinds of forms of motion of space swing, designed the alternative exercise test stand of two covers, reasonable in design, compactness; And whole dynamic environment test is omnidistance carries out accurately control by control system, and it is reliable to operate steadily, and test operation is easy.

Embodiment
This device is become one by private environment chamber, exercise test stand and control system three segment sets and constitutes.Exercise test stand and control system all are contained in the private environment chamber.Referring to Fig. 1-1 and Fig. 1-2, be provided with stand supporting seat 3 in the inner chamber of private environment chamber, be used for the mounted movable test-bed, view window 2 is arranged on the Qianmen of chamber, be used for the viewing test situation.Provide ozone generator 11, muddy water spray equipment 10, the heating and cooling device 13 of environmental baseline to be installed in respectively on the casing 9 of interior top of chamber of chamber and bottom, motor 12 also is installed in the casing, the output of motor 12 connects the transmission shaft of exercise test stand, for the exercise test stand provides power.The appropriate location also is provided with the circuit module of control system 8 in the casing.Control system 7 connects motor 12, ozone generator 11, muddy water spray equipment 10 and heating and cooling device 13 respectively by operation circuit, with control test temperature, ozone concentration and muddy water amount, control system is also passed through environment control panel 4, motion control panel 5 and the power supply control panel 7 on circuit connect box 9 surfaces, by selection test condition is set, the control test run to the function key on the control panel.Control system also is provided with computer interface 6, also can test condition be set by external computing machine, the control test run.
Referring to Fig. 2, the core of the electronic control part of control system 7 is CPU, the CPU condition of work: the rest circuit that resets, power supply and clock clock circuit.CPU I/O output terminal is controlled silicon controlled component 15 by 7404 conversions, and drive motor 8 work are because of motor is an alternating current generator, so isolate with light lotus root 14.I/O end in another road of CPU shows by driving decoding LCD.Another interface of CPU connects printer 17 print results.Connect motion control panel 5 by keyboard interface.By external computing machine of RS-232 communication interface and printer 16, connect another single card microcomputer.By temperature, ozone, muddy water controller 9,10,11, measuring sonde is to carry out environment control.The complete machine power supply comprises AC/DC, and high-low voltage power source 19 is by independently power supply control panel 7 controls.
The exercise test stand has two covers, and a cover is the flat stretching motion test of supplying water, and referring to Fig. 3-1, is made of bracing frame 20-10, rotation axis 20-5, wheel disc 20-1, connecting rod 20-3, slide block 20-6, parts such as sample supporting rod A, B.Bracing frame 20-10 is used for combining with 3 installations of chamber stand supporting seat, bracing frame 20-10 goes up by supporting base 20-4 the transmission shaft 20-5 that is connected with motor 12 is installed, wheel disc 20-1 is installed on the top of transmission shaft, wheel disc is by connecting rod 20-3, connecting pin 20-7 connects slide block 20-6, slide block is installed on the slide block bearing 20-8, but horizontal slip, slide block is provided with sample supporting rod A, an end that is used for the clamping rubber part, sample supporting rod B is established in the position relative with the direction of motion of slide block, the other end that is used for the clamping rubber part, sample supporting rod B is fixed on the bracing frame 20-10 by sample supporting base 20-9.
The another set of of exercise test stand is for space oscillating motion test, referring to Fig. 3-2, is made of bracing frame 21-12, rotation axis 21-5, wheel disc 21-1, connecting rod, rocking bar 21-9, sample supporting rod 21-10 etc.Bracing frame 21-12 is used for combining with stand supporting seat 3 installations of chamber, and bracing frame 21-12 goes up by supporting seat 21-4 the transmission shaft 21-5 that is connected with motor 12 is set, and wheel disc 21-1 is installed on the top of transmission shaft, and wheel disc is again by connecting rod connection rocking bar 21-9.Connecting rod is an adjustable structure, is formed by connecting by the adjustable connecting-rod 21-6 at two and the screw rod 21-7 of centre, and adjustable connecting-rod 21-6 is connected by connecting pin 21-2 with wheel disc 21-1, and there is radiai adjustment groove 21-3 the junction.Rocking bar one end is provided with sample bare terminal end C, can be used for clamping rubber part one end, rocking bar connects sample supporting rod 21-10 one end by bearing pin 21-8, and sample supporting rod bottom is provided with sample bare terminal end D, and the sample supporting rod is fixed on the bracing frame 21-12 by sample supporting base 21-11.
With said apparatus the gear side protective cover of minicar steering linkage assembly is carried out dynamic long duration test:
The forms of motion level is shunk and the space swing
Experimental enviroment :-40 ℃
The test operation step:
One, horizontal contractile motion test:
1, opens the chamber Qianmen, horizontal contractile motion test-bed is installed on the stand supporting seat in the cabinets cavity.
2, the clamping rubber part is installed:
On the sample supporting rod A of stand, the small end clamping of rubber part is used the dead ring clamping respectively on sample supporting rod B, make rubber part be in free state with the big end clamping of rubber part.
3, regulation and control movement velocity:
The start-up control system power supply, on chamber control panel or external computing machine, set the horizontal contractile motion speed of rubber part, press the motion key, rubber part was tried out 5 minutes, confirm that the rubber part moving situation is no abnormal, press stop key, make rubber part be in free state, closing test case Qianmen.
4, regulation and control test temperature:
On the chamber control panel, press the refrigeration key, setting the rubber part test temperature is-40 ℃, press the operation key, when the control panel indication reaches the setting test temperature and is in temperature constant state, press the operation key of control system, dynamically the low temperature long duration test formally starts, and control system enters work, and the chamber panel shows movement velocity and times of exercise automatically.
Two, space oscillating motion test:
1, opens the chamber Qianmen, space oscillating motion test-bed is installed on the stand supporting seat in the cabinets cavity.
2, the clamping rubber part is installed:
With the big end clamping of rubber part on the D end of the sample supporting rod of stand, the sample bare terminal end C of the small end clamping of rubber part on rocking bar, use the dead ring clamping respectively, make rubber part be in free state, regulate and control connecting pin, adjustable connecting-rod and screw rod with computer simulation, make the space pendulum angle Pass Test specified angle of rocking bar.
3, regulation and control movement velocity: the control methods of same level contractile motion test;
4, regulation and control test temperature: the control methods of same level contractile motion test.
